

Henley Men’s 2s were forced to settle for a point in an entertaining 2–2 draw with Thame Men’s 1s this weekend.
Henley started brightly and were rewarded with the lead early on. Nico Jean-Jean carved open the defence and found a killer pass to captain Will Beaumont who deflected home for 1-0.
Thame responded well and gradually worked their way back into the contest as they found an equaliser, sending the teams into half time level at 1–1.
Henley regained the advantage in the second half with another well-worked attacking move. This time Robert Farina produced an excellent run forward before picking out Nico Jean-Jean, who finished confidently to restore Henley’s lead.
Once again, however, Thame refused to go away and managed to draw level for a second time. From there the visitors defended resolutely, frustrating Henley in the closing stages and denying them a late winner they felt their performance merited.
